Carly Simon, 62, has now returned with a new album. The deal is a partnership with Starbucks.
After telling the gay press she “was not gay” in an interview a few months back, Simon went on to further explain on Howard Stern’s radio show earlier today.
“Have I made love to a woman? No. Now, I have been ‘come on’ to, but I was too uptight. But I wish that I had. I think that I’m too old for that (now). I have a fantastic boyfriend now who’s almost a woman.”
Simon wishing she’d made love to a woman in her life almost sounds like your standard Stern Playboy Bunny gimmick, but somehow, Simon kept the conversation serious and above the belt.
